Hmm, although it's still theoretical (have played a lot but haven't actually "owned"), the HSh (Hum-Sing-miniHum) combo (perhaps with a blend pot, I have and love it on my hSh Strat but ain't all that clear on a HSh) seems to be what I really liked the best.
I need a fat enough (but at the same time articulate enough) bridge for heavy parts and solo (which a mini humbucker just doesn't seem to deliver), my favorite clean sound is Strat's neck+mid where I find that a mini-humbucker on the neck is perfect in that it gives me plenty of "chunk" for lead parts and still holds it's own with the quack of a S (on my Strat, dunno how it'll fare on other guitars). Plus, since I almost always place my pick in the space between the neck and middle pu I have no problem with hitting the m. pu like others do while I can use it for a more EQ balanced, lower output sound (for rockier situations or less aggressive gain in general).
In short, every pu has its' place while there is nothing I want to do but can't with this setting.
HSH would be my second but I can't think of a way to properly use all the desired options without making it too complicated.
